pub struct FormatParser<'a> {
input: &'a [u8],
pos: usize,
}
impl<'a> FormatParser<'a> {
#[inline]
pub const fn new(input: &'a [u8]) -> Self {
FormatParser { input, pos: 0 }
}
#[inline]
fn pop(&mut self) -> Option<u8> {
if self.pos < self.input.len() {
let val = Some(self.input[self.pos]);
self.pos += 1;
val
} else {
None
}
}
#[inline]
fn peek(&self) -> Option<u8> {
self.input.get(self.pos).copied()
}
#[inline]
fn advance(&mut self, step: usize) {
self.pos += step;
}
#[inline]
fn back(&mut self, step: usize) {
self.pos -= step;
}
#[inline]
fn remain(&self) -> Option<&[u8]> {
if self.pos < self.input.len() {
Some(&self.input[self.pos..])
} else {
None
}
}
#[inline]
fn punctuation_count(&mut self, expect: u8) -> u8 {
self.remain().map_or(0, |rem| {
rem.iter().take_while(|&y| y.eq(&expect)).count() as u8
})
}
#[inline]
fn parse_year(&mut self) -> Field {
let remain = match self.remain() {
Some(rem) => rem,
None => return Field::Invalid,
};
let len = remain
.iter()
.take(4)
.take_while(|&y| y.eq_ignore_ascii_case(&b'y'))
.count();
if len > 0 {
self.advance(len);
Field::Year(len as u8)
} else {
Field::Invalid
}
}
#[inline]
fn parse_hour(&mut self) -> Field {
let ch = match self.pop() {
Some(ch) => ch,
None => return Field::Invalid,
};
if ch != b'H' && ch != b'h' {
return Field::Invalid;
}
match self.remain() {
Some(rem) => {
if rem.starts_with(b"24") {
self.advance(2);
Field::Hour24
} else if rem.starts_with(b"12") {
self.advance(2);
Field::Hour12
} else {
Field::Hour12
}
}
None => Field::Hour12,
}
}
#[inline]
fn parse_second(&mut self) -> Field {
match self.pop() {
Some(b'S') | Some(b's') => Field::Second,
_ => Field::Invalid,
}
}
#[inline]
fn parse_fraction(&mut self) -> Field {
match self.pop() {
Some(b'F') | Some(b'f') => match self.peek() {
Some(ch) if ch.is_ascii_digit() => {
self.advance(1);
let p = ch - b'0';
if (1..=9).contains(&p) {
Field::Fraction(Some(p))
} else {
Field::Invalid
}
}
_ => Field::Fraction(None),
},
_ => Field::Invalid,
}
}
#[inline]
fn parse_am(&mut self) -> Field {
let remain = match self.remain() {
Some(rem) => rem,
None => return Field::Invalid,
};
if remain.len() >= 4 {
let rem = &remain[0..4];
match rem {
b"A.M." | b"A.m." | b"a.M." => {
self.advance(4);
return Field::AmPm(AmPmStyle::UpperDot);
}
b"a.m." => {
self.advance(4);
return Field::AmPm(AmPmStyle::LowerDot);
}
_ => {}
};
}
if remain.len() >= 2 {
let rem = &remain[0..2];
return match rem {
b"AM" | b"Am" | b"aM" => {
self.advance(2);
Field::AmPm(AmPmStyle::Upper)
}
b"am" => {
self.advance(2);
Field::AmPm(AmPmStyle::Lower)
}
_ => Field::Invalid,
};
}
Field::Invalid
}
#[inline]
fn parse_month_name(&mut self) -> Field {
let remain = match self.remain() {
Some(rem) => rem,
None => return Field::Invalid,
};
if CaseInsensitive::starts_with(remain, b"month") {
return match &remain[0..2] {
b"MO" => {
self.advance(5);
Field::MonthName(NameStyle::Upper)
}
b"Mo" => {
self.advance(5);
Field::MonthName(NameStyle::Capital)
}
_ => {
self.advance(5);
Field::MonthName(NameStyle::Lower)
}
};
}
if CaseInsensitive::starts_with(remain, b"mon") {
return match &remain[0..2] {
b"MO" => {
self.advance(3);
Field::MonthName(NameStyle::AbbrUpper)
}
b"Mo" => {
self.advance(3);
Field::MonthName(NameStyle::AbbrCapital)
}
_ => {
self.advance(3);
Field::MonthName(NameStyle::AbbrLower)
}
};
}
Field::Invalid
}
#[inline]
fn parse_day_name(&mut self) -> Field {
let remain = match self.remain() {
Some(rem) => rem,
None => return Field::Invalid,
};
if CaseInsensitive::starts_with(remain, b"day") {
return match &remain[0..2] {
b"DA" => {
self.advance(3);
Field::DayName(NameStyle::Upper)
}
b"Da" => {
self.advance(3);
Field::DayName(NameStyle::Capital)
}
_ => {
self.advance(3);
Field::DayName(NameStyle::Lower)
}
};
} else if remain.len() >= 2 {
return match &remain[0..2] {
b"DY" => {
self.advance(2);
Field::DayName(NameStyle::AbbrUpper)
}
b"Dy" => {
self.advance(2);
Field::DayName(NameStyle::AbbrCapital)
}
_ => {
self.advance(2);
Field::DayName(NameStyle::AbbrLower)
}
};
}
Field::Invalid
}
#[inline]
fn parse_pm(&mut self) -> Field {
let remain = match self.remain() {
Some(rem) => rem,
None => return Field::Invalid,
};
if remain.len() >= 4 {
let rem = &remain[0..4];
match rem {
b"P.M." | b"P.m." | b"p.M." => {
self.advance(4);
return Field::AmPm(AmPmStyle::UpperDot);
}
b"p.m." => {
self.advance(4);
return Field::AmPm(AmPmStyle::LowerDot);
}
_ => {}
};
}
if remain.len() >= 2 {
let rem = &remain[0..2];
return match rem {
b"PM" | b"Pm" | b"pM" => {
self.advance(2);
Field::AmPm(AmPmStyle::Upper)
}
b"pm" => {
self.advance(2);
Field::AmPm(AmPmStyle::Lower)
}
_ => Field::Invalid,
};
}
Field::Invalid
}
fn next(&mut self) -> Option<Field> {
match self.pop() {
Some(char) => {
let field = match char {
b' ' => {
let len = self.punctuation_count(b' ');
self.advance(len as usize);
Field::Blank(len + 1)
}
b'-' => Field::Hyphen,
b':' => Field::Colon,
b'/' => Field::Slash,
b'\\' => Field::Backslash,
b',' => Field::Comma,
b'.' => Field::Dot,
b';' => Field::Semicolon,
b'_' => Field::Underline,
b'A' | b'a' => {
self.back(1);
self.parse_am()
}
b'D' | b'd' => match self.peek() {
Some(ch) => match ch {
b'D' | b'd' => {
self.advance(1);
match self.peek() {
Some(ch) => match ch {
b'D' | b'd' => {
self.advance(1);
Field::DayOfYear
}
_ => Field::Day,
},
None => Field::Day,
}
}
b'a' | b'A' | b'Y' | b'y' => {
self.back(1);
self.parse_day_name()
}
_ => Field::DayOfWeek,
},
None => Field::DayOfWeek,
},
b'F' | b'f' => self.parse_fraction(),
b'H' | b'h' => self.parse_hour(),
b'M' | b'm' => match self.peek() {
Some(ch) => match ch {
b'I' | b'i' => {
self.advance(1);
Field::Minute
}
b'M' | b'm' => {
self.advance(1);
Field::Month
}
b'O' | b'o' => {
self.back(1);
self.parse_month_name()
}
_ => Field::Invalid,
},
None => Field::Invalid,
},
b'P' | b'p' => {
self.back(1);
self.parse_pm()
}
b'S' | b's' => self.parse_second(),
b'T' => Field::T,
b'Y' | b'y' => {
self.back(1);
self.parse_year()
}
b'W' | b'w' => match self.peek() {
Some(ch) => match ch {
b'W' | b'w' => {
self.advance(1);
Field::WeekOfYear
}
_ => Field::WeekOfMonth,
},
None => Field::WeekOfMonth,
},
_ => Field::Invalid,
};
Some(field)
}
None => None,
}
}
}
impl<'a> Iterator for FormatParser<'a> {
type Item = Field;
#[inline(always)]
fn next(&mut self) -> Option<Field> {
self.next()
}
}

fn write_u32<W: fmt::Write>(mut w: W, value: u32, width: usize) -> Result<()> {
debug_assert!(width < 11 && width > 0);
let mut buf: [u8; 11] = [b'0'; 11];
let mut index: usize = 10;
let mut val = value;
while val >= 10 {
let v = val % 10;
val /= 10;
buf[index] = v as u8 + b'0';
index -= 1;
}
buf[index] = val as u8 + b'0';
let len = 11 - index;
if width > len {
index -= width - len;
}
let s = unsafe { std::str::from_utf8_unchecked(&buf[index..11]) };
w.write_str(s)?;
Ok(())
}
#[inline]
fn expect_char(s: &[u8], expected: u8) -> bool {
matches!(s.first(), Some(ch) if *ch == expected)
}
#[inline]
fn parse_number(input: &[u8], max_len: usize) -> Result<(bool, i32, &[u8])> {
let (negative, s) = match input.first() {
Some(ch) => match ch {
b'+' => (false, &input[1..]),
b'-' => (true, &input[1..]),
_ => (false, input),
},
None => {
return Err(Error::ParseError(
"the input is inconsistent with the format".try_to_string()?,
))
}
};
let (digits, s) = eat_digits(s, max_len);
if digits.is_empty() {
return Err(Error::ParseError(
"a non-numeric character was found where a numeric was expected".try_to_string()?,
));
}
let int = digits
.iter()
.fold(0, |int, &i| int * 10 + (i - b'0') as i32);
let int = if negative { -int } else { int };
Ok((negative, int, s))
}
#[inline]
fn eat_digits(s: &[u8], max_len: usize) -> (&[u8], &[u8]) {
let i = s
.iter()
.take(max_len)
.take_while(|&i| i.is_ascii_digit())
.count();
(&s[..i], &s[i..])
}
#[inline]
fn eat_whitespaces(s: &[u8]) -> &[u8] {
let i = s.iter().take_while(|&i| i.is_ascii_whitespace()).count();
&s[i..]
}
